Australia, the reigning champions from 2021, are set to kick off their campaign at the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up 2026 against Ireland in a Group B showdown at the R. Premadasa Stadium in Colombo on Wednesday, February 10. With skipper Mitchell Marsh leading the squad, the Australian team will be missing their key fast bowlers Mitchell Starc, Pat Cummins, and Josh Hazlewood. Starc has retired from the T20 format, while Cummins and Hazlewood were unable to recover in time for the prestigious tournament, despite being part of the initial squad. Adding to their challenges, Australia is coming off a 0-3 series whitewash against Pakistan.
On the other side, Ireland will be playing their second match in the tournament after facing a defeat against Sri Lanka on February 8. This upcoming clash against Australia is crucial for Ireland as they aim to avoid further setbacks in their quest to qualify for the Super Eights stage in this twenty-team tournament.
### Match Details at R. Premadasa Stadium, Colombo
The match will take place at the iconic R. Premadasa Stadium in Colombo, known for its bowler-friendly pitch, especially for spinners. In a previous T20 World Cup encounter at the venue between Sri Lanka and Ireland, only 306 runs were scored in total, indicating the challenging conditions for batsmen.

### Probable Best Performers
**Probable Best Batter: Travis Head**
Travis Head, the explosive Australian opener, will be a player to watch in this match. Known for his ability to turn the game around in pressure situations, Head will be eager to make a mark in the T20 World Cup after a tough series in Pakistan.
**Probable Best Bowler: Adam Zampa**
Experienced spinner Adam Zampa is expected to shine in this match. Given Ireland’s struggle against spin in their previous game, Zampa will look to dominate with his leg-spin variations and pose a significant threat to the Irish batting lineup.
